Output 66c6fecf5ec93d04f4ee51347a344fe3d7c4e15ef1db6396a62be68f10e3d2f1:1

value
1463892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6c2f080ac91da0f77d2301448700c20532ff07a OP_EQUAL
address
3JMNS65AVus6woFMfi5FneeaBRxC4e2VYe
transaction
66c6fecf5ec93d04f4ee51347a344fe3d7c4e15ef1db6396a62be68f10e3d2f1
spent
true